Pierre Cauchon

French Catholic bishop and inquisitor
Born
1371 654 years ago
Died
December 18th, 1442 582 years ago — 71 years old

Served as a prominent bishop in France during the early 15th century. Presided over the trial of Joan of Arc, playing a key role in her condemnation. Held the position of Bishop of Beauvais, which influenced ecclesiastical politics. Cauchon was involved in the complexities of regional power struggles amid the Hundred Years' War, aligning with English interests at a critical time.

Andrija Mohorovičić

Seismologist, discovered Mohorovičić Discontinuity
Born
January 23rd, 1857 168 years ago
Died
December 18th, 1936 88 years ago — 79 years old

This individual contributed significantly to the fields of meteorology and seismology. The discovery of the Mohorovičić Discontinuity in 1909 provided a crucial understanding of the Earth's structure. This layer, located between the Earth's crust and mantle, is fundamental to the study of seismic waves. Extensive research and publications established a strong foundation for future seismic studies in the region. Specialized in earthquake research, studies greatly influenced the methodologies used in seismology today.
